RAIN BY THE FOOT
4 ON THE EAST COAST IN JANUARY Referring io January weather, Mr. A. T. Ngata, M.P., said that the rainfall experienced on the East Coast during the past month could not be measured bv inches, as it fell in feet. It was one of the wettest Januarvs ever known in tho district. Tliev were well over their shearing before the wet weather came on, but one bad effect' of the lush, moistureladen growth of grass which had come on at a time when the pastures were, as a rule, brown and hard, was backwardness on the part of the lambs. Thev would not fatten on the soaked grass, and lost condition by continued scouring-
